This procurement will result in one IDIQ contract for structural multi-discipline A-E services for industrial facilities located within PWD Maine’s AOR, including, but not limited to, Portsmouth Naval Shipyard in Kittery, Maine as well as other sites in Maine, New Hampshire, Massachusetts, Connecticut, Rhode Island, New York, and Vermont, but may also include work worldwide. These services will be procured in accordance with 40 USC Chapter 11, Selection of Architects and Engineers, as implemented by FAR Subpart 36.6. The IDIQ contract will be for a base period of one year and four one-year option periods (if exercised).
The total fee for the contract term shall not exceed $30,000,000. The guaranteed minimum for the contract term (including option years) is $5,000 and will be satisfied by simultaneous award of the initial task order with the basic contract. Firm-fixed price task orders will be negotiated for this contract. There will be no dollar limit per task order and no dollar limit per year. The estimated start date is April 2017.
This proposed contract is being solicited on an UNRESTRICTED basis. The North American Industry Classification System (NAICS) Code is 541330, Engineering Services, and the Small Business size standard is $15,000,000. The Government seeks the most highly qualified firm to perform the required services, based on the demonstrated competence and qualifications, in accordance with the selection criteria.
Comprehensive A-E services are required for the new construction, repair, replacement, demolition, alteration, and/or improvement of industrial facilities.
Projects may involve single or multiple disciplines, including, but not limited to, structural, civil, mechanical, plumbing, electrical, architectural, environmental, planning, fire protection, cost estimating, geotechnical, landscape architecture, and/or interior design. The types of projects may include: office buildings; manufacturing facilities; industrial storage facilities; security/entry-control facilities; modular steel structures; lifting and handling fixtures; bridge crane rail systems; automatic transport systems; material transport systems; industrial processes/systems; historic structures; and building and waterfront related utilities (e.g., steam; low pressure compressed air; fresh water; salt water; sanitary sewer; oily waste water collection; high voltage to low voltage electrical; fire protection and alarm systems; control systems; lighting; and communications (telephone, television, fiber optics, cyber security, SCADA, and local area network)).
